It doesn’t seem that long ago that I was on Hampstead Heath with Reuben & Jess doing a pre-wedding shoot with them and now here I am posting the shots from their wedding! It was such a beautiful wedding and Jess looked amazing. I loved the classic ‘Grecian’ style of her wedding dress and it worked so well with her vintage style hair piece. Rather then choosing a traditional guestbook, we set up a photobooth with a basket full of props and shot as many of the guests we could on polaroid film and they were all pasted into a lovely leather book, with everyone writing their messages in it. It was a huge success and as the evening got late we were still in full flow with a never ending stream of people. It was funny to see not only the kids but also adults too getting into the spirit of things and dressing up. I haven’t laughed so hard in a long time.

It was a lovely December day with perfect sunshine for Mark & Claire’s wedding. Tewin Bury Farm Hotel is a great wedding venue and I enjoy shooting there. The staff are experts in wedding organisation and they always help the day run smoothly. The wedding ceremony & breakfast was held in the Stable, which is a lovely 17th century red brick building with oak beams and a cosy feel. Claire looked radiant on her wedding day and the day went beautifully.
